- 2) Mark your calendar! Our first MacApp Conference is scheduled for February
- 5-9 at the San Diego DoubleTree Inn. Beginner and intermediate workshops and
- tutorials are planned for Monday, Tuesday and Wednesday. General conference
- sessions will be held Thursday and Friday. Costs will be $125 per full-day
- workshop or tutorial ($180 non-members) and $250 for the two-day general
- sessions ($360 non-members). These costs include registration, materials,
- continental breakfast and lunch. General conference sessions also include one
- dinner (Thursday evening). Hotel and airfare not included. The program is
- being finalized now and you should be receiving a conference brochure and
- registration material in the mail in about two or three weeks. There are still
- openings for workshop and tutorial instructors---if you are interested in
- leading a workshop or tutorial, contact the MADA office or Dave Wilson, (415)
- 494-6763 or ALink WILSON6. If you would like to demo a MacApp-based
- application or present a paper, contact Tony Meadow, (415) 644-9400 or ALink
- D0068.
